Texas Roadhouse butter chicken is a creamy, spiced dish inspired by restaurant flavors, blending tender chicken in a velvety tomato-based sauce with aromatic spices. Perfect for family dinners, gatherings, or meal prep.
Ingredients

- 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s
- 4 tablespoons butter
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 tablespoon grated ginger
- 1 can (14 oz) crushed tomatoes
- 1 cup heavy cream (or coconut milk for dairy-free)
- 1 teaspoon garam masala
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- ½ teaspoon turmeric
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on salt
- Fresh cilantro, for garnish
- Optional: 2 tablespoons cashew paste or almond butter for creaminess
Instructions
- Heat butter and ol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
- Sauté garlic and ginger until fragrant.
- Add chicken pieces; cook until browned on all sides, then remove and set aside.
- In the same skillet, add crushed tomatoes, garam masala, cumin, turmeric, paprika, and salt. Simmer for 5–7 minutes.
- Stir in heavy cream, then return chicken to the skillet.
- Simmer for 15–20 minutes, until chicken is cooked through and sauce thickens.
- Garnish with fresh cilantro and serve hot with rice or naan.
Notes
- Use high-quality spices for maximum flavor.
- Simmer longer for richer, more concentrated sauce.
- Finish with an extra pat of butter for shine and richness.
- Customize with tofu or chickpeas for a vegan option.
- Store leftovers in the fridge for 3 days or freeze up to 3 months.
